Cleopatra VII (Leader of Egypt) Cleopatra VII, known as simply Cleopatra, was one of the most famous female leaders and rulers in history. She was the last active pharaoh of Ptolemaic Egypt, from 51 B.C. to 30 B.C. WebMar 4, 2024 · Wu Zetian (625-705), Empress of China, 7th-8th century. Wu Zetian is the only woman in over three thousand years of Chinese history to rule in her own right. Wu entered the palace of Tang emperor, Taizong, as a junior concubine at the age of 14.
